Adjusting Low Burner Flame Size

1. Push and turn burner control knob to LITE position.
• Burner sparks until gas ignites.
2. Set flame to low position.
3. Remove burner control knob.
4. Turn screw in center of burner control stem using
small standard screwdriver until flame is adjusted.
5. Replace control knob.
6. Push and turn burner control to test burner flame.

Installing Grill Module

Grill module must be installed in right module reservoir.
Before operating grill module for first time, lightly coat top
of grill grates with cooking oil to prevent sticking.
!
WARNING
To avoid risk of personal injury, all controls must be in
off position before removing or installing modules.
1. Turn all control knobs to OFF position.
2. Place grease pan into module reservoir as shown
below.
3. Remove grill grates from grill module.
4. While holding module with air shutter openings
towards rear, push module onto orifices.
• Module must cover orifices completely.

5. Place module into module reservoir.
• When module is installed correctly, it should not
slide.
6. Replace grill grates.

Removing Grill Module

1. Turn all control knobs to OFF position. Allow grill
module to cool.
2. Remove grill grates.
3. Locate tab on front of module.
4. Lift module up and slide out while holding
by front tab.
5. After module clears orifices, remove module
from range.

Operating Grill Module

!
To avoid risk of serious personal injury, property
damage, or fire, do not leave grill unattended while in
operation. Grease and spillovers can ignite causing a
fire.
!
To avoid risk of property damage, do not use metal
cooking utensils on grill.
1. Before operating grill module, lightly coat top of grill
grates with cooking oil to prevent sticking.
2. Trim excess fats from meats.
3. Push in and turn right front control knob to LITE
position.
4. After right side module burner ignites, turn control to
desired setting.
5. Push in and turn the right rear control knob to LITE
position.
6. After left side module burner ignites, turn control to
desired setting.
• Fan automatically comes on at low speed.
7. Preheat grill for approximately 10 minutes to improve
charbroiled flavor and to decrease food sticking.
8. When finished cooking, turn control knob to OFF
position.
9. Wait 15 minutes for grill pan and grill accessories to
cool before cleaning.
